Why Squid Game is Netflix’s biggest hit

Squid Game is the latest series on Netflix based on South Korea’s debt crisis was released on September 17, 2021. This is a nine-episode Korean thriller that could be the streaming service’s best non-English show in the world.

The Squid Game is about a group of adults indebted and desperate to make money. They then find themselves in a competition where they are required to play children’s games in order to win approximately  33 million or US$38 million. The Catch? If they lose they die!

Seong Gi-hun is a divorced chauffeur who is deeply indebted. He then accepted an offer to go to an undisclosed location where he finds himself among 455 players to play games to win the money. The players are kept under lock and key by armed guards in pink suits with games overseen by the Front Man. Gi-hun then allies with other players, including his childhood friend Cho Sang-woo, to try to survive the physical and psychological twists of the games

The creator of the show  Hwang Dong-hyuk wrote the script of the movie several years ago but was rejected by a number of studios until he found Netflix in 2019. He wrote and directed all the episodes himself.
